@@paulapumphrey7857 It was written for Gladys Knight but was first recorded by The Miracles but not released for 2 years in October '68. Then Marvin Gaye recorded it but it wasn't released until August '68. Finally Gladys Knight recorded it and it was released in late '67. Her version became the best selling Motown recording. Then 8 or 9 months later Marvin Gaye's version exceeded hers. The first recording was the third released, the third recording was the first released, and the second was the second. The CCR version was 1970. Convoluted, I know.
